
Zach Jones’ Fading Flowers musically chronicles his journey of closing one chapter and starting over, reflecting on lessons learned while building a new life 3,000 miles from home. Pulling from Jones’ real life experiences, this highly personal album manages to speak to larger universal truths, like the complexity of relationships and the challenges of facing new obstacles when you’ve only got yourself to rely on.
